In preparation for tomorrow’s Pretty Little Liars’ Halloween episode “This is a Dark Ride”, ABC Family has released new details about when Pretty Little Liars will return for its winter season.

Pretty Little Liars will renew its third season on a more regular basis on January 8. The show will compete against CBS’ NCIS, NBC’s The Voice, and ABC’s Dancing with the Stars: All-Stars in this time slot however the shows usually don’t attract the same audiences. The Lying Game will follow Pretty Little Liars, premiering at 9 p.m EST on January 8. Switched at Birth will return January 7 at 8 p.m EST while Bunheads will follow at 9 p.m. EST. Do you plan to watch these shows as well?

The plot for the January 8 episode is Mona (Janel Parrish) heavy. Mona has evolved into a complex and devious character this season. Are you excited to see more Mona? The spoiler filled synopsis is below.

“Radley Sanitarium has given Mona a clean bill of health and she is headed back to the halls of Rosewood High, much to the Liars’ dismay. With their former tormentor now back in their everyday life, Aria, Emily, Hanna and Spencer take very different views of the “new” Mona. Sure she made their lives a living hell, but is she really cured? And what other secrets could she be holding onto? It is up to Mona to prove to the Liars if she has changed or not.”
